  • Original Description

    In Charles Hunt’s charming genre painting Feeding Time, Two Country Girls Feeding A Calf In A Stable, the warmth of rural life unfolds tenderly. Set in a rustic stable bathed in soft, diffused light, two young girls engage in the humble yet intimate act of feeding a calf—their focused expressions and gentle postures radiating innocence and pastoral simplicity. Hunt, a 19th-century British artist renowned for his detailed domestic and rural scenes, captures textures masterfully—from the rough wood of the trough to the calf’s velvety muzzle—imbuing the scene with palpable realism. Though less celebrated than his contemporaries like Sir Edwin Landseer, Hunt’s works are prized for their narrative warmth and technical precision, reflecting Victorian England’s fascination with idealized country life. This piece, with its quiet storytelling and delicate interplay of light and shadow, epitomizes the sentimental realism popular in mid-1800s British art.
